深入解析MySQL数据库管理与优化:智能化工具助力高效开发

最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E

深入解析MySQL数据库管理与优化:智能化工具助力高效开发

在当今快速发展的科技领域,数据库作为信息存储和处理的核心组件,其重要性不言而喻。尤其是在企业级应用中,MySQL以其高性能、可靠性和易用性成为了众多开发者和企业的首选。然而,随着数据量的不断增长和业务逻辑的日益复杂,传统的数据库管理和开发方式已经难以满足高效开发的需求。幸运的是,借助智能化工具如InsCode AI IDE,我们可以显著提升MySQL数据库的使用效率和管理水平。

MySQL数据库管理的现状与挑战

MySQL作为一种开源关系型数据库管理系统,自推出以来就受到了广泛欢迎。它支持多种操作系统,并且拥有丰富的功能和良好的性能表现。但是,在实际项目中,MySQL的管理和开发仍然面临着诸多挑战:

  1. 复杂的查询语句编写:为了实现高效的查询,开发者需要编写复杂的SQL语句,这不仅耗时而且容易出错。
  2. 性能调优难度大:随着数据量的增长,如何确保数据库的性能成为了一个棘手的问题。传统的手动调优方法往往费时费力,且效果不佳。
  3. 代码维护困难:当项目规模扩大时,数据库相关的代码变得越来越庞大,维护起来非常困难。

面对这些挑战,传统的方式往往是通过增加人力投入或依赖于经验丰富的DBA(数据库管理员)来解决。但这种方式不仅成本高昂,而且难以保证持续稳定的输出。此时,智能化工具的引入便显得尤为重要。

InsCode AI IDE:MySQL开发者的得力助手

简化查询语句编写

InsCode AI IDE内置了强大的AI对话框功能,使得即便是没有深厚SQL基础的新手也能轻松完成复杂的查询任务。例如,在创建一个包含多表联结的查询时,用户只需简单地描述需求,InsCode AI IDE就会自动生成相应的SQL语句。此外,它还能够根据上下文环境智能推荐最佳实践,帮助开发者避免常见的错误。

自动化性能调优

对于那些对性能敏感的应用来说,及时发现并解决问题至关重要。InsCode AI IDE集成了先进的性能分析工具,可以自动检测潜在的瓶颈,并给出具体的优化建议。更重要的是,它可以直接执行部分优化操作,大大减少了人工干预的时间和风险。比如,当系统检测到某个查询存在全表扫描的情况时,它可以建议添加适当的索引以提高查询速度;或者当某些表的数据量过大影响了整体性能时,它会提示进行分库分表等策略调整。

提升代码可读性和可维护性

除了简化查询语句编写和自动化性能调优外,InsCode AI IDE还在其他方面为MySQL开发者提供了极大的便利。例如,它支持自动生成注释,确保每一行代码都有清晰的解释;同时,它也能够生成单元测试用例,确保每次修改后的代码依然正确无误。最重要的是,所有这一切都是通过简单的自然语言交互完成的,极大地方便了用户的使用体验。

实际应用场景展示

为了让读者更直观地了解InsCode AI IDE在MySQL开发中的应用价值,我们来看几个具体案例:

案例一:电商平台商品库存管理

在一个大型电商平台上,商品库存信息需要实时更新,并且要保证高并发访问下的准确性。传统的做法是通过编写复杂的触发器和存储过程来实现这一目标,但这不仅增加了系统的复杂度,同时也提高了出错的概率。而借助InsCode AI IDE,开发者可以通过自然语言描述业务逻辑,自动生成符合要求的SQL语句。不仅如此,InsCode AI IDE还可以根据历史数据分析出哪些操作可能会导致性能问题,并提前给出预警和改进建议。

案例二:金融行业数据报表生成

金融机构每天都会产生海量的数据,如何从这些数据中提取有价值的信息成为了一个关键问题。以前,分析师们通常需要花费大量时间编写复杂的SQL查询语句才能得到所需的结果。现在,有了InsCode AI IDE的帮助,他们只需要简单地描述想要获取的数据类型及条件,系统便会迅速生成相应的查询语句,并返回结果。更重要的是,InsCode AI IDE还具备强大的可视化功能,可以直接将查询结果以图表形式展示出来,方便进一步分析。

结语

综上所述,无论是对于初学者还是资深专家而言,InsCode AI IDE都是一款不可多得的MySQL开发利器。它不仅极大地简化了日常开发工作,提升了工作效率,更重要的是,它为开发者提供了一个更加友好、智能的工作环境。如果您正在寻找一款能够真正改变您编程方式的工具,请立即下载并尝试InsCode AI IDE吧!它将带给你前所未有的编程体验,让你在MySQL的世界里畅游无阻。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

inscode_041

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值